The Scope of the Released Documents
The Justice Department's release represents a massive undertaking, with over 3 million files related to its investigations into convicted sex offender Jeffrey Epstein over the past two decades. This unprecedented release of information provides an unprecedented glimpse into the inner workings of one of the most notorious criminal cases of our time.
The sheer volume of documents - including thousands of videos and images - has created both excitement and concern among researchers, journalists, and the general public. The department has made these files available through a public database, allowing anyone with internet access to examine the materials. This level of transparency is unprecedented for such a sensitive case, though it also raises questions about privacy and the potential for misinterpretation of complex legal documents.

The Ongoing Release Process
While the Department of Justice released approximately 3 million Epstein files on Friday, officials have indicated that this represents only a portion of the total documents that will eventually be made public. The plan calls for the release of an additional 3.5 million pages of new files related to Jeffrey Epstein in the coming weeks and months.
This staggered release approach has generated both anticipation and frustration among those following the case. On one hand, the gradual release allows for more careful review and analysis of the materials. On the other hand, it means that crucial information may be withheld from the public for extended periods, potentially hampering efforts to fully understand the scope of Epstein's crimes and his network of associates.
